The Rise of Carbon Fiber Car Rims A Revolution in Automotive Engineering


In recent years, the automotive industry has witnessed a significant shift toward the use of advanced materials, with carbon fiber emerging as a frontrunner in this evolution. Among its diverse applications, carbon fiber car rims are gaining attention for their exceptional performance benefits, aesthetic appeal, and contribution to sustainability. This article explores the advantages of carbon fiber rims and their impact on the future of automotive engineering.


What is Carbon Fiber?


Carbon fiber is a high-strength, lightweight material made from tightly bonded carbon atoms. It is known for its incredible stiffness, low weight, and excellent durability, making it ideal for applications where strength-to-weight ratio is crucial. Traditionally utilized in aerospace and high-performance motorsports, carbon fiber is now making its mark in consumer automotive markets, particularly in the development of car rims.


Advantages of Carbon Fiber Car Rims


1. Weight Reduction One of the most significant advantages of carbon fiber rims is their reduced weight compared to traditional aluminum or steel rims. A lighter rim not only enhances the overall performance of the vehicle but also contributes to improved fuel efficiency. Reducing unsprung weight allows for better handling, increased acceleration, and shorter stopping distances, making carbon fiber rims particularly appealing to performance enthusiasts and racing applications.


2. Increased Strength and Durability Carbon fiber rims exhibit superior strength compared to conventional materials. This strength translates to better resistance against the wear and tear of everyday driving, as well as performance under extreme conditions. Carbon fiber's non-corrosive properties also mean that these rims can withstand various environmental factors, such as moisture and road salt, extending their lifespan and reducing maintenance costs.


3. Aesthetic Appeal Beyond their functional benefits, carbon fiber rims offer a unique and modern aesthetic that many car enthusiasts find appealing. The distinctive weave pattern of carbon fiber provides a sleek and sporty look, enhancing the visual appeal of any vehicle. Customization options are also available, allowing car owners to choose finishes that match their personal style, from matte to gloss, or even colored weaves.

4. Improved Ride Quality The unique properties of carbon fiber can lead to improved ride quality. Because these rims can be engineered to provide a specific amount of flexibility while maintaining strength, they can contribute to a more comfortable driving experience. By dampening vibrations and responding well to road imperfections, carbon fiber rims can enhance the overall driving enjoyment.


The Sustainability Factor


As the automotive industry moves toward more sustainable practices, carbon fiber presents an increasingly attractive option. While the traditional manufacturing process of carbon fiber is energy-intensive, advancements are being made to develop more eco-friendly methods. Additionally, carbon fiber's lightweight nature contributes to fuel efficiency, ultimately reducing the vehicle's carbon footprint. The emphasis on lighter materials aligns with the growing demand for greener vehicles, complementing the move toward electric and hybrid cars.


Challenges Ahead


Despite their numerous advantages, carbon fiber rims do have some challenges to overcome. The initial cost of production is significantly higher than that of aluminum or steel rims, which can be a barrier for widespread adoption among average consumers. Additionally, the repair processes for carbon fiber can be complex and often require specialized knowledge and equipment. As technology progresses, we may see more affordable production methods and repair solutions that could enhance the accessibility of carbon fiber rims.
